- The distance between Montreal, Quebec, Canada and Bajsun, Uzbekistan is approximately 9,908 km or 6,157 mi.
- To reach Montreal, Quebec in this distance one would set out from Bajsun bearing 333.6° or NNW and follow the great circles arc to approach Montreal, Quebec bearing 209.9° or SSW .
- Montreal, Quebec has a warm summer continental/ hemiboreal climate with no dry season (Dfb) whereas Bajsun has a mid-latitude cool desert climate (BWk).
- Montreal, Quebec is in or near the cool temperate moist forest biome whereas Bajsun is in or near the cool temperate steppe biome.
- The annual mean temperature is 7.1 °C (12.8°F) cooler.
- Average monthly temperatures vary by 6.9 °C (12.4°F) more in Montreal, Quebec. The continentality subtype is truly continental as opposed to subcontinental.
- Total annual precipitation averages 891.5 mm (35.1 in) more which is equivalent to 891.5 l/m² (21.88 US gal/ft²) or 8,915,000 l/ha (953,073 US gal/ac) more. About 8 1/8 as much.
- The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 7.3° lower in Montreal, Quebec than in Bajsun.
- Relative humidity levels are 16.7% higher.
- The mean dew point temperature is 2.9°C (5.1°F) lower.
